Franklin Square is one of western Nassau County's most densely populated hamlets, located in the Town of Hempstead between Hempstead Turnpike and the Southern State Parkway. Lots here are typically 50 to 60 feet wide with modest setbacks, which means every patio project requires precise measurement, tight-tolerance cutting, and drainage plans that account for close proximity to neighboring properties and structures.
Many Franklin Square homes were built in the late 1940s and 1950s and feature small concrete patios or stoops that were never designed for outdoor entertaining. Brothers Paving specializes in replacing these aging surfaces with custom paver patios that transform compact backyards into functional outdoor rooms. We use design techniques like diagonal paver patterns, contrasting border courses, and strategic planting pocket cutouts to make smaller patios feel larger — while engineering proper pitch and drainage to keep water moving away from foundations on these tightly spaced lots.

Learn MoreFranklin Square's compact lot sizes mean drainage is critical — water from your patio cannot be directed onto a neighbor's property. We engineer every Franklin Square patio with precise surface pitch toward designated runoff zones, installing channel drains or dry wells where the lot layout doesn't allow sufficient natural drainage. The area's soils are mixed outwash and till that compact well for base material, but we verify conditions on every property since fill from past construction is common in this densely developed community.
